Sir Alex Ferguson has confirmed he met with Cristiano Ronaldo in Portugal last week to discuss the player's future and insists the winger will not be sold to Real Madrid.

 

The 23-year-old has been openly coveted by Real Madrid over the last few months with the player himself reported to be keen on a switch to the Bernabeu.

 

However' date=' at a press conference in South Africa to mark the start of United's pre-season trip, the Reds' boss reiterated the club's stance that Ronaldo is going nowhere.

 

"The meeting went well - I think we both put across our points of view - where we stand and where the player stands," explained Sir Alex.

 

"I can say he'll be a Manchester United player next season. That's our stance - he won't be sold."

 

Many of the tabloids had speculated that comments attributed to Ronaldo over his desire to move to Madrid may have put a strain on his relationship with his manager. But Sir Alex says that has never been the case.

 

"It?s not a difficult position. I was on my holiday and I was not going to interrupt my holiday, believe me," he insisted after being asked why he had not commented on the matter up to this point.

 

"I wasn?t panicked because the player is under contract so the strength and the rights are with Manchester United.

 

"What we have done well is to say nothing. We?ve kept quiet on this matter and kept it private and what I said to Cristiano remains private. I did go and see him last week in Portugal and it was very amicable ? there were no problems. That?s where we are and we carry on."

 

The winger is currently recovering from ankle surgery and Sir Alex confirmed Ronaldo is unlikely to be back in action until October.

 

"He?s had an operation and he?ll be out for three months," said the manager. "He?s on crutches for the first four weeks, he?ll be in rehabilitation for the next four and then the following four he?ll be back into football training. The time mapped out is three months and we won?t bring him back a day earlier than that.

 

"I think when players have operations we have a responsibility that the player comes back 100 per cent and we?ll carry that out as we normally do. There?ll be no risk-taking ? we never take risks. Our goal is to always make sure that the player gets back 100 per cent and that will be the same in the case of Cristiano Ronaldo."
